How To Bake Cream Cheese Banana Bread

Step 1: Warm Up The Oven

Fire up your oven to 350°F (175°C). Prep a 9×5-inch loaf pan by coating it with butter and dusting with flour, or line it with parchment paper for easy removal.

Step 2: Mash And Mix Banana Magic

In a spacious mixing bowl, transform ripe bananas into a smooth pulp. Fold in:
  • Melted butter
  • Granulated sugar
  • Brown sugar

Crack in eggs and splash vanilla extract, stirring until everything dances together harmoniously.

Step 3: Combine Dry Ingredients

In a separate bowl, whisk together:
  • All-purpose flour
  • Baking soda
  • Salt
  • Ground cinnamon (optional but recommended)

Gently integrate these dry ingredients into the banana mixture, stirring until just combined.

Step 4: Whip Up Creamy Cheese Goodness

Using an electric mixer, blend until silky smooth:
  • Cream cheese
  • Granulated sugar
  • Egg
  • Vanilla extract

Step 5: Layer With Love

Pour half the banana batter into the prepared pan. Carefully spread the cream cheese mixture over this layer. Crown with remaining banana batter, ensuring complete coverage.

Step 6: Bake To Perfection

Slide the pan into the preheated oven. Bake for 50-60 minutes. Check doneness by inserting a toothpick – it should come out clean. If the top browns too quickly, create a foil tent for the last 10-15 minutes.

Step 7: Cool And Slice

Allow bread to rest in the pan for 10 minutes. Transfer to a wire rack and let cool completely before slicing into heavenly pieces.

How To Store And Reheat Cream Cheese Banana Bread

  • Refrigerate: Wrap cooled banana bread tightly in plastic wrap or place in an airtight container. Store in the refrigerator for up to 5 days.
  • Freeze: Slice the bread, wrap each piece individually in plastic wrap, then place in a freezer bag. Freeze for 2-3 months for maximum freshness.
  • Thaw: Remove from freezer and let sit at room temperature for 1-2 hours or overnight in the refrigerator.
  • Reheat: Warm slices in the microwave for 15-20 seconds or toast in a preheated oven at 350F for 5-7 minutes until slightly crispy on the edges.

Ingredients

Scale

Cream Cheese Banana Bread

Main Ingredients:

  • 2 3 ripe bananas (about 1 cup mashed / 240 ml)
  • 1 ¾ cups (220 g) all-purpose flour
  • ½ cup (115 g / 115 ml) unsalted butter, melted
  • 2 large eggs

Sweeteners and Sugars:

  • ½ cup (100 g) granulated sugar
  • ¼ cup (55 g) brown sugar, packed
  • ¼ cup (50 g) granulated sugar (for cream cheese layer)

Flavor Enhancers and Additional Ingredients:

  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• ½ teaspoon vanilla extract (for cream cheese layer)
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on ground cinnamon (optional)
  • 8 oz (225 g) cream cheese, softened
  • 1 large egg (for cream cheese layer)

Instructions

  1. Prepare the baking environment by warming the oven to 350F (175C). Create a non-stick surface in a 9×5-inch loaf pan using butter or parchment paper.
  2. Transform ripe bananas into a silky smooth consistency by mashing thoroughly. Incorporate melted butter, both white and brown sugars, blending seamlessly with eggs and vanilla extract until the mixture achieves a uniform texture.
  3. Craft the dry foundation by whisking flour, baking soda, salt, and optional cinnamon in a separate vessel. Gently fold these powdery ingredients into the banana mixture, stirring minimally to maintain a tender crumb.
  4. Whip the cream cheese mixture to a velvety consistency, combining cream cheese, sugar, egg, and vanilla until perfectly smooth and free of lumps.
  5. Construct the bread’s architecture by layering half the banana batter into the prepared pan. Delicately spread the cream cheese mixture across this first layer, ensuring even distribution.
  6. Complete the layering by covering the cream cheese with remaining banana batter, creating a harmonious blend of flavors and textures.
  7. Slide the pan into the preheated oven, allowing the bread to transform for 50-60 minutes. Monitor the surface, draping aluminum foil loosely if browning occurs too rapidly.
  8. After baking, grant the bread a brief 10-minute rest in the pan before transferring to a cooling rack. Permit complete cooling before slicing to preserve the bread’s delicate structure.

Notes

  • Elevate the texture by using overripe, spotty bananas for maximum sweetness and deeper flavor profile.
  • Avoid overmixing the batter to prevent tough, dense bread by gently folding ingredients until just combined.
  • Swap regular flour with gluten-free blend for a celiac-friendly version, ensuring same measurements and consistency.
  • Reduce sugar content by using natural sweeteners like honey or maple syrup for a healthier alternative without compromising moisture.
